Christine
Taylor to Star in Hallmark Original Movie "Farewell, Mr. Kringle"
4/20/10
CHRISTINE TAYLOR STARS IN 'FAREWELL MR. KRINGLE,' A HALLMARK CHANNEL
ORIGINAL MOVIE WHICH HAS BEGUN PRODUCTION
Holiday Movie Will Premiere on Hallmark Channel in 2010
Christine Taylor ("The Brady Bunch Movie," "Zoolander")
has been cast to star in "Farewell Mr. Kringle," a heartwarming
Hallmark Channel Original Movie about a skeptical journalist who is
assigned to chronicle the 50th anniversary of Kris Kringle, a Santa Claus
in the town of Mistletoe. As her involvement in the town grows, she begins
to open up to the enchantment of Christmas and some other wonders of the
season.
The holiday movie has begun production and will premiere on Hallmark
Channel in December, 2010.
After 50 years, Mistletoe's Santa Claus is hanging up his hat and Anna
Walls (Taylor), a magazine writer, is assigned to find out what makes this
Santa tick. Having tragically lost her husband on Christmas Eve, Anna has
become a nonbeliever. But with the help of Mark Stafford (Christopher
Wiehl, "Jericho"), a former cutthroat divorce lawyer turned
compassionate bed and breakfast owner, she finds there is something
magical about this particular Santa. Through various conversations with
the townspeople, Anna quickly discovers how much Kris Kringle means to the
small town, and how much Christmas means to Kris Kringle. And having lost
his wife years before during the holidays, he is the perfect person to
show Anna the true meaning of Christmas, while Mark recaptures more than
just Anna's Christmas spirit.
"Farewell Mr. Kringle" is being produced by Larry Levinson
Productions. Larry Levinson, is the executive producer. Brian Gordon and
Jim Wilberger are the producers. Kevin Connor ("The Wish List")
is directing from a script written by Robert Tate Miller ("Secret
Santa").
Source: Hallmark Channel Press Release
